Understanding Mental Illness in Ainsworth, IN

Any condition that negatively affects our psychological well-being is a a mental illness. Because all of our self-worth and communications are dependent on our mental health, it is detrimental that we take care of Mental Illness when we become aware of it. If someone has difficulty processing their thoughts and emotions in a productive way, they can quickly feel distantanced and struggle with self-esteem. Unfortunately, another frequent result of mental illness is turning to drugs & alcohol as a means to self-medicate. When this happens, a person's mental Illness can go untreated for years—allowing things to become much, much more serious. When this happens, we usually suggest looking for a Dual Diagnosis facility. This way, both diseases can be treated simultaneously.

Types of Mental Health Providers in Ainsworth, IN

Mental illness manifests differently for different people. As such, there are multiple types of mental health professionals that use different techniques and serve distinct roles.

Psychologists in Ainsworth

Psychologists are qualified to conduct psychological evaluations and issue diagnoses. These individuals are highly adept at helping individuals understand and cope with their feelings and thoughts, and usually do so through talk therapy in an individual or group setting. Much of their practice revolves around addressing and resolving destructive and otherwise unhealthy behaviors.

Psychiatrists in Ainsworth

Sometimes an individual needs more immediate or intense treatment compared to what a psychologist can offer - namely prescription medication. Psychiatrists are physicians (medical doctors) who specialize in mental illness and therefore can offer prescription medication. Even though, they are trained and qualified to conduct psychotherapy (talk therapy), not all psychiatrists do.

Therapists, Counselors & Clinicians in Ainsworth

Each of these terms are interchangeable and are used to describe mental health care professionals with a masters-level education in fields such as psychology, marriage and family therapy, or other specialties. As they are not physicians, they tend to treat mental health issues with approaches similar to psychologists. More often than not, individual and group therapy is the primary mode of treatment offered.
